Some of the trickiest birds to film are pelagic species. One can hunker down on a headland in a gale and hope for the best, or one can actively pursue the birds by going on a tailor-made cruise. Our footage library was sorely in need of decent high-definition European Storm-petrel, and many of the shearwaters. So we dispatched Stephen Menzie and Steve Rutt to Scilly — having told them not to come back until they had captured full-frame Stormies. Would they succeed? Would they rack up an enormous hotel bill and dip everything? Watch and see.
